Account Recovery — Quenlow Portal (contractor notes)

Since build 4.2, the Quenlow session-token refresher silently drops tokens older than 20 minutes, which can lock operators out mid-recovery. If a user reports repeated logouts during recovery, do not restart the auth pod; that clears the pending grant. Instead, open the recovery console, select the affected account, and choose "Reissue Grant." The console will prompt for the team recovery passphrase before proceeding. Enter the passphrase exactly as shown below.

unlock words, hahap-yawig: pelix-kelion-tamys-jorix-julok

Quick note on exports: Bramblework reports are always generated in UTC, then shifted to the customer's account timezone — so if someone says their numbers look "a day off," check their timezone setting first. To poke at the export service yourself from the support console, authenticate with the key below.

gateway credential: kto3_qfe

Quick handover on the Crumbwell order-cutoff rule: cutoff is enforced server-side in `cutoff_guard.rb`, client timer is cosmetic only. Heads up for review — the override flag bypasses the check entirely and is gated by an admin role. Questions on the threat model should go to the owner below.

account owner for kafop-haweg: Pelax Gilael Istir

Subject: Telemetry compression cut-over done

Welcome aboard, and quick context: we finished moving the Glimmerpost telemetry pipeline to compressed payloads last Thursday. All agents now gzip batches before shipping to the Norrel collectors, and the old uncompressed path is retired. Bandwidth dropped about 55%, dashboards unchanged. If you're setting up a local agent for testing, point it at staging and use the configuration below.

settings of fafog-haduf:
ZORIX_PIN=4648
ZORIX_METRICS_HOST=metrics.zorix.paliqsys.corp
ZORIX_LOG_LEVEL=info
ZORIX_TENANT=druix